Evan Williams White Bottled-In-Bond: Your Guide to 100 Proof Perfection Discover | Explore | Uncover> Evan Williams White Bottled-In-Bond, a remarkable offering from the esteemed Evan Williams portfolio. This time-honored bourbon isn’t just another entry; it's a testament to the Bottled-In-Bond Act of 1897, guaranteeing its authenticity and quality. Clocking in at a powerful 100 proof – that's 50% ABV – this expression delivers a rich flavor profile that truly shines. Experience > the notes of toffee, alongside hints of spice and a satisfying finish, all hallmarks of Evan Williams’ commitment to crafting exceptional American whiskey. It's an ideal choice for both seasoned bourbon enthusiasts and those new to the world of high-proof spirits, presenting a genuine taste of Kentucky. A Review The Evan Williams White BIB, or Bag-in-Box, has garnered significant attention within the spirit community. Many folks are wondering if this affordable, larger-format offering truly delivers. While it’s undeniably economical, and a fantastic option for cocktails, the flavor profile doesn't quite reach the heights of their bottled counterparts. The character is noticeably milder and lacks some of the depth you’d expect, presenting more of a youthful, somewhat simple experience. It's perfectly adequate for casual enjoyment or large gatherings where cost is a primary concern, but serious bourbon aficionados might find it disappointing. Ultimately, the value proposition copyrights on your expectations and budget – it’s a good buy, but not necessarily a must-have for everyone seeking a complex or nuanced sip.
